Zapala in Winter
In winter (June, July and August), Zapala sees average daytime highs around 9°C and overnight lows near -1°C, with 136 mm of precipitation over about 22 wet days across the season. It is the coldest season of the year and the wettest season of the year.
Over the season highs climb from about 9°C in early June to 11°C by late August.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 39% of the time across winter, and the air most often feels dry.

Temperature in Zapala in Winter
Over the season highs climb from about 9°C in early June to 11°C by late August.
A typical winter day in Zapala reaches about 9°C and drops to -1°C overnight. The warmest of the three months is August, the coolest July.

Where is Zapala?
Zapala sits at 38.9°S, 70.1°W, 1,019 m above sea level, in Argentina. The nearest listed city is Cutral-Có, 72 km away.
Topography around Zapala
How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Zapala.
Within 3 km, the terrain around Zapala has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 122 m around an average of 1,023 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 502 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,343 m.
The land around Zapala is covered by grassland (56%) and artificial surfaces (27%) within 3 km, grassland (79%) within 16 km, and grassland (66%) and bare terrain (21%) within 80 km.
